Transaction 852651c22fcef48388181dc92972af18166a7e76868e2cd92012154453a37076
1 Input
2 Outputs
- 852651c22fcef48388181dc92972af18166a7e76868e2cd92012154453a37076:0
- 852651c22fcef48388181dc92972af18166a7e76868e2cd92012154453a37076:1
value 28765
address 3QNrqDu7zQcsCn1ddECCfHsoBLrhV7Foje
value 54816
address 1EtmqpR7zuzjdtJBmHxvmTr9LYtoNN1He8